26 TROUBLESHOOTING Wi-Fi Problem Possible Cause The password for the Wi-Fi network was entered incorrectly. Mobile data for your smartphone is turned on. Trouble connecting appliance and smartphone to Wi-Fi network. The wireless network name (SSID) is set incorrectly. The router frequency is not 2.4 GHz. The appliance is too far from the router. Solutions Delete your home Wi-Fi network and begin the registration process again. Turn off the Mobile data on your smartphone before registering the appliance. The wireless network name (SSID) should be a combination of English letters and numbers. (Do not use special characters.) Only a 2.4 GHz router frequency is supported. Set the wireless router to 2.4 GHz and connect the appliance to the wireless router. To check the router frequency, check with your Internet service provider or the router manufacturer. If the appliance is too far from the router, the signal may be weak and the connection may not be router closer to the appliance or purchase and install a Wi-Fi repeater.
